The Landscape of Material Handling in Turkey

Analyzing the operational challenges and environmental demands of conveyor systems in the Turkish industrial corridor.

Turkey's strategic position as a bridge between Europe and Asia has fostered a massive industrial base, particularly in cement, steel, and mining. In regions like Marmara and Central Anatolia, the demand for robust idlers and rollers is driven by the need to transport bulk aggregates across varied terrains with high efficiency.

Environmental factors, including significant temperature fluctuations between the coastal regions and the interior highlands, place extreme stress on conveyor components. This necessitates the use of high-grade steel idler rollers that can resist thermal expansion and contraction without compromising bearing precision.

Furthermore, the shift toward automated logistics in Turkish ports and manufacturing hubs has increased the requirement for precision-engineered belt conveyor roller systems that minimize friction and energy consumption, aligning with national goals for sustainable industrial growth.

Market Development History

In the late 20th century, the Turkish conveyor market relied heavily on oversized, basic steel components. These early systems focused on raw strength but suffered from high noise levels and frequent failures due to lack of precise alignment tools.

Around 2010, the industry transitioned toward specialized components. The introduction of the training idler became a turning point, allowing operators to correct belt misalignment dynamically, which significantly reduced belt wear and downtime in large-scale quarries.

By the 2020s, the focus shifted toward material science. Advanced coatings and precision-machined bearings were integrated into the manufacturing process, transforming standard rollers into high-efficiency components capable of supporting higher tonnage with lower rotational resistance.

Common Questions for Turkey Industrial Clients

Expert answers to the most frequent technical queries regarding conveyor maintenance and selection.

How do I choose the right steel idler rollers for abrasive mining materials?

For abrasive materials, we recommend rollers with high-carbon steel shells and specialized heat-treatment or ceramic coatings to increase surface hardness and wear life.

Can a training idler solve chronic belt misalignment in long conveyors?

Yes, training idlers are specifically designed to pivot and steer the belt back to center automatically, reducing manual adjustment needs and belt edge damage.

What is the average lifespan of a belt conveyor roller in a cement plant?

Depending on the load and dust levels, our precision rollers typically last 2-3 times longer than standard parts due to our advanced labyrinth sealing systems.

How do I maintain my belt conveyor pulley to prevent slippage?

Regularly inspect the pulley lagging for wear and ensure proper tensioning. Using high-friction rubber lagging can significantly improve grip and reduce energy loss.

Which belt conveyor roller material is best for coastal port environments?

For coastal areas, we recommend galvanized steel or stainless steel options to prevent corrosion caused by high salinity and humidity.
